      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hello,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I have not been able to connect my rebel sl2 using the usb to any windows 10 PC; I've tried 3 different PCs. It makes the sound that I've connected a device but nothing happens after that. I continue to get the same errors in device manager (screenshot below). I understand that if installed properly it should show up under "portable devices" but nothing is there. I also can't see the memory card in file explorer.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;IMG src="https://community.usa.canon.com/t5/image/serverpage/image-id/19630iB56AA9A01B89E309/image-size/original?v=1.0&amp;amp;px=-1" border="0" alt="SL2.PNG" title="SL2.PNG" width="356" height="394" /&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I've tried the following: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;- Multiple USB cords including the canon brand IFC-400PCU&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;- Different USB ports on multiple PCs&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;- Tried reformatting the memory card&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;- Connecting with and without the memory card. When there is a memory card in the camera it tends to freeze and says "busy" when I press any of the buttons&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;- Uninstalling the "unknown USB device" in device manager but every time I plug the camera in again the same error/device shows up&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;- Installed the windows MTP update (saw that this helped in another thread)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;- Reinstalled the firmware on the camera&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;- Turned off wifi on camera&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;- Turned off auto shutdown on camera&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;- Installed the most up to date EOS Utility however, this seems like a driver/hardware problem and not a software issue&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Any help would be greatly appreciated.       <description>&lt;P&gt;Hello TB40,&amp;nbsp;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Downloading all images that have not been transferred to the computer&lt;/P&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;1. Connect the camera to the computer with the interface cable supplied with the camera.&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;&lt;UL&gt;&lt;LI&gt;Set the camera's Auto Power Off settings to [Off] or [Disable] before making the connection.&lt;/LI&gt;&lt;LI&gt;For more information on connecting the camera to a computer, please refer to the instruction manual included with the camera.&lt;/LI&gt;&lt;/UL&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;2. Set the camera's power to [ON].&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;3. EOS Utility Ver. 3.2 starts automatically.&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;If EOS Utility Ver. 3.2 does not start automatically, click the [Start] button, then select [All Programs], [Canon Utilities], [EOS Utility] and then [EOS Utility].&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;BLOCKQUOTE&gt;&lt;DIV class="ps_note"&gt;NOTE&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;DIV class="ps_note_val"&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;&lt;UL&gt;&lt;LI&gt;Windows 8: Right-click on the [Start] screen, and then click [All Programs] displayed on the lower right of the screen. [EOS Utility] will be displayed on the [Apps] screen.&lt;/LI&gt;&lt;LI&gt;Windows 8.1: Click on the bottom left of the [Start] screen to display the [Apps] screen, and then click [EOS Utility].&lt;/LI&gt;&lt;LI&gt;Mac OS X: Click the [EOS Utility] icon on the Dock.&lt;/LI&gt;&lt;/UL&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;/BLOCKQUOTE&gt;&lt;BLOCKQUOTE&gt;&lt;DIV class="ps_important"&gt;IMPORTANT&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;DIV class="ps_important_val"&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;If you start EOS Utility Ver. 3.2 before connecting the camera to the computer, the [EOS Utility Launcher] screen (shown in the example image below) will be displayed. In this case, please click [Close], and connect the camera to the computer after the window has closed.&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;&lt;IMG src="https://support.usa.canon.com/library/attachments/CanonUSA/TroubleshootingContents/Images/Global/G0187117.gif" border="0" alt="" title="" /&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;/BLOCKQUOTE&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;4. When the window shown below is displayed, click [Download images to computer].&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;IMG src="https://support.usa.canon.com/library/attachments/CanonUSA/TroubleshootingContents/Images/Global/G0187119.gif" border="0" alt="" title="" /&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;5. Click [Start automatic download] to download all the images on the memory card to the computer.&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;IMG src="https://support.usa.canon.com/library/attachments/CanonUSA/TroubleshootingContents/Images/Global/G0187120.gif" border="0" alt="" title="" /&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;BLOCKQUOTE&gt;&lt;DIV class="ps_note"&gt;NOTE&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;DIV class="ps_note_val"&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;By default, the downloaded images are sorted into folders by their shooting date, and are saved in the [Pictures] folder on the computer. If you wish to change the destination for the downloaded images, click [Preferences] and specify the settings in the dialog box.&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;&lt;IMG src="https://support.usa.canon.com/library/attachments/CanonUSA/TroubleshootingContents/Images/Global/G0187122.gif" border="0" alt="" title="" /&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;/BLOCKQUOTE&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;If you click [Select and download], you can select the images you want and download them to your computer from the cameras memory card. For the details, please see the "Downloading selected images" section below.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;6. Download of images to the computer begins.&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;IMG src="https://support.usa.canon.com/library/attachments/CanonUSA/TroubleshootingContents/Images/Global/G0187123.gif" border="0" alt="" title="" /&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;7. When all images have been downloaded, Digital Photo Professional starts up automatically and the downloaded images are displayed in Digital Photo Professionals main window.&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;BLOCKQUOTE&gt;&lt;DIV class="ps_note"&gt;NOTE&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;DIV class="ps_note_val"&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;If you wish to edit images using Digital Photo Professional or ImageBrowser EX, refer to the individual software instruction manuals.&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;&lt;/BLOCKQUOTE&gt;</description>
